Russia to cut oil exports by 300,000 bpd in Sept.

Russia announced on Thursday it will cut oil exports by 300,000 barrels per day in September in a bid to ensure balance at global oil markets.

“Within the efforts to ensure the oil market remains balanced Russia will continue to voluntarily reduce its oil supply in the month of September, now by 300,000 barrels per day, by cutting its exports by that quantity to global markets,” Russian Deputy Prime Minister Alexander Novak was quoted by Russian Tass news agency as saying.

He added that this move comes in the context of a voluntary decision to cut oil exports next September.
